How to maintain nm400 wear-resistant plate

随机图片

Nm400 wear-resistant plate is made of nm360 wear-resistant steel, which is specially treated and processed through multiple processes. The hardness, strength and impact resistance of nm400 wear-resistant plate have been greatly improved, and its service life has also been extended. In industrial production, it has a very wide range of uses, such as in construction, It has a wide range of applications in mechanical processing, metal structures, etc. So, how to maintain nm400 wear-resistant plate? Next, let us find out! #nm400 wear-resistant plate#

1. The surface of nm400 wear-resistant plate is clean and kept clean. If the surface is dirty, rinse it with clean water and dry it with a clean cloth.

2. Be careful to avoid scratches. Due to the high hardness of nm450 wear-resistant steel plate, scratches on it should be minimized during use.

3. Do not expose the material to sunlight for a long time. Because sunlight will accelerate the oxidation rate of materials and affect their service life.

4. Do not weld outdoors. Although the outdoor temperature is low, there is a lot of moisture and dust in the air, which will affect the welding quality and even cause welding failure.

5. Do not disassemble it at will. Once it is damaged or deformed and needs to be replaced, reassemble it to avoid accidents.

6. Prevent rust. If rust is found, remove it promptly and apply anti-rust oil.
